    Can you please tell me where the "turbo" thing is coming from? I've heard that a lot lately.

    The idea that diet may be better off as a shock to the system originally came from me. When I started off designing the LE Diet it seemed equally plausible that it would be best to hit it hard and fast on diet vs. slow and steady. So we had people doing both options at the beginning. IMMEDIATELY it became glaringly, obviously clear that 2-4 weeks (even when people were very very strict) was completely ineffective, 6-8 weeks was better but still underwhelming, 8-10 weeks better still, and at all points 12 weeks or beyond we had results in the 70% and up range (these numbers fluctuate a bit but this is the average over the 7 years of the site). It has been visibly, measurably clear that less time on diet is not adequate even when the people are strict (because everyone who diets a short time is stricter than those who diet longer) and thus ever after that I no longer recommend anything less than 6 weeks and more like 10-12 is my preference.
